Triple Power
A new take on an old tradition, the Commander collection of reclining furniture features a marvelous twist on the coveted Charles of London style arms. The flaring at the lower section, smoothly flows the transition between the arms and seat ottoman areas. Round welt accents saddle bag style arm pads which smoothly flow into transitionally shaped wings. The most comfortable back construction, the double bustle backs feel supple yet supportive for hours of relaxation. Available in Triple Power, fingertip controls allow for infinite adjustments of power reclining, power headrest, and power lumbar support to fine tune your position. The Commander even has USB-C charging capabilities. Order it in your favorite color or covering with hundreds of fabrics or over 40 leathers.

- Included Features - Next Level Reclining - Take your recliner to the next level'' and enhance your comfort. The Next Level mechanism provides the ability to recline with your feet above your heart. This feature helps optimize circulation and reduces pressure on your neck, back, and legs. In addition to the many health benefits, the Next Level Reclining extended ottoman gives 3 of extra length while fully reclining.
